Did you know?
São Tomé and Príncipe sits almost exactly on the intersection of the equator and the prime meridian — as close to the 'centre of the Earth' as any country gets.
About São Tomé and Príncipe
São Tomé and Príncipe is a nation located in Africa, with São Tomé serving as its capital city. Home to a population of ~200 thousand, it is a country shaped by a rich history, diverse geography and the living cultures of its people. Portuguese is the primary language spoken across the country, and the São Tomé and Príncipe dobra serves as the official currency.
